"When we think of #greenhousegas emissions, we tend to think of tailpipes and factories," said Scott Tiegs, co-author of the study and a professor of biological sciences at Oakland.
"But a lot of carbon dioxide and methane comes from aquatic #ecosystems. This process is natural. But when humans add nutrient #pollution like #fertilizer to fresh waters and elevate water temperatures, we increase the decomposition rates and direct more #CO2 into the atmosphere."

As of December 2023, the Federal Election Commission has received 59 complaints alleging that Donald Trump or his committees violated the Federal Election Campaign Act. In 29 of those cases, nonpartisan staff in the FEC’s Office of General Counsel recommended the FEC investigate Trump.
Yet not once has a #Republican#FEC commissioner voted to approve any such investigation or enforcement of the law against Trump, a new CREW analysis found.

@AlaskaCenterforEnergyandPower, @acep wants data from you!
ACEP is leading research in the potential for electric vehicles in #Alaska as part of its Electric Vehicles in the Arctic project; team is especially interested in data on electric pick-ups, SUVs, ATVs driven through winter in areas that get to -30F or colder, to update the Alaska Electric Vehicle calculator and inform further research.

…notably threatens its responsible and secure use.#JailbreakAttacks use adversarial prompts to bypass #ChatGPT's #ethics safeguards…
"This technique encapsulates the user's query in a system prompt that reminds ChatGPT to respond responsibly,…Experimental results demonstrate that self-reminders significantly reduce the success rate of jailbreak attacks against ChatGPT from 67.21% to 19.34%."
